Hypercholesterolemia is a condition characterized by high cholesterol concentration in blood. This is a risk factor for many diseases. Glucagon Like Peptide-1 (GLP-1) is an incretin hormone that affects cholesterol and other diseases with hypercholesterolemia as a risk factor. Drug that widely used for hypercholesterolemia is simvastatin which can increase GLP-1. GLP-1 also can be increased by high fibrous foods consumption, one of which is galactomannan which can be found in coconut as much as 61%. This study aimed to determine the effect of galactomannan on GLP-1 and compared with simvastatin. Wistar rats were induced into hypercholesterolemia and than treated with galactomannan 70 mg/200gBW/day and 140 mg/200gBW/day and simvastatin 0,1 mg/200gBW/day. After 28 days, GLP-1 levels was measured. The result showed that GLP-1 in 140 mg/200gBW/day group was the highest and in 70 mg/200gBW/day group was the lowest. Data analysis revealed no significant difference between 140 mg/200gBW/day and simvastatin group. In conclusion, galactomannan 140 mg/200gBW/day had the same potency as simvastatin 0,1 mg/200gBW/day.
